How much do part time appraisal data collector j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 16, 2026, the average hourly pay for part time appraisal data collector in the United States is $20.20,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$16.35 and $24.04 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is the difference between Part Time Appraisal Data Collector vs Part Time Real Estate Appraiser?

AspectPart Time Appraisal Data CollectorPart Time Real Estate Appraiser
CredentialsNone required or basic certificationState licensing or certification often required
Work EnvironmentFieldwork collecting property data, often flexible hoursFieldwork and report writing, more detailed analysis
Industry UsageData collection for appraisal reports, supporting appraisersPerforming independent property valuations

While both roles involve fieldwork related to real estate, the Part Time Appraisal Data Collector primarily gathers property data to support appraisals, often with minimal certification. In contrast, the Part Time Real Estate Appraiser conducts independent property valuations, requiring licensing and more detailed analysis. The data collector role is more focused on data gathering, whereas the appraiser role involves comprehensive valuation work.

Retail Data Collection Associate Part Time
  • Garland, TX
  • Part-time
Job Description

Responsible for collecting and transmitting data gathered from designated retail stores primarily using a hand-held scanning device.  Take direction from the Supervisor and other management individuals.  Responsible for meeting defined standards of work volume, quality, accuracy, completeness, and timeliness.  Maintain a positive relationship with employees and customers as a representative of CROSSMARK. Essential Duties and Responsibilities

Collect and transmit consumer product data gathered from designated retail stores as assigned by:

  • Counting forward reserve inventories
  • Reconciling purchases (invoices) against inventories
  • Scanning UPC codes via hand-held device
  • Collecting display and promotional information
  • Inputting product price information
  •  Collecting and entering custom survey observational data
  • Transmitting collected data daily via internet based on the requirements of the collection device
  • Plan and organize assigned work within CROSSMARK Retail Data Collection by: In-store observation studies
  •  Training updates
  • Task lists
  • Store assignments
  • Newsletters
  • Occasionally downloading and printing forms
  • Meet CROSSMARK Retail Data Collection defined standards of work volume, quality, accuracy, cost containment, completeness, and timeliness by:
  • Complying with travel and mileage standards established by Retail Data Collection
  • Following management and CROSSMARK expectations on cost containment
  • Completing assignments and transmitting data according to CROSSMARK's established procedures and deadlines
  • Submitting time card and expense information in accordance with CROSSMARK's established procedures and schedule
  • Communicate effectively with management and coworkers by:
  • Communicating no less than weekly with district management regarding schedules/issues
  • Checking email daily for operational updates
  • Returning all phone calls within 1 business day and all emails within 2 business day
  • Attending all market, team, and other meetings, as required
  • Advising management of promotional activity changes within retail outlets
